Unconscious: needs, wishes, and conflicts that lie below the surface of conscious awareness, on a different level of awareness, freudian idea. Consciousness may have developed through evolution as perhaps a little forethought and planning may have been valuable in survival. Consciousness is from the activity in distributed networks of neural pathways. Electroencephalograph (eeg): a device that monitors the electrical activity of the brain over time by means of recording electrodes attached to the surface of the scalp, in terms of brain waves. Biological rhythms: periodic fluctuations in physiological functioning; these mean than organisms have internal biological clocks that monitor the daily alternation of light and darkness, annual pattern of the seasons, and phases of the moon. Circadian rhythms: 24 hour biological cycles found in humans and many other species; used in regulation of sleep particularly, also rhythmic variations in blood pressure, urine production, hormonal secretion, and other physical functions like alertness, short-term memory etc.
